Just Between Lovers (2017) is a deeply emotional and heartfelt drama that explores the lives of two individuals bound by a tragic event. The story follows Lee Kang-doo, a young man who has been struggling with the trauma of a devastating accident that took the lives of many, including his family. Despite the physical and emotional scars, he continues to move forward, living a life overshadowed by the past. His world collides with Ha Moon-soo, a woman who also carries the weight of the same accident, having lost her younger brother in the incident. As their paths cross, they begin to share their grief and find solace in each other’s company. However, their journey towards healing is far from easy, as both are haunted by memories of the past and must learn to confront their pain in order to move forward. As they navigate through love, loss, and emotional recovery, they find that sometimes, the most difficult part of healing is allowing yourself to love again. The drama beautifully portrays the struggle of overcoming personal trauma and the power of love and human connection in the face of profound sorrow.
